Innovations in Pump Technology

As technology continues to advance, the features available in gypsum discharge pumps have also evolved. Today’s pumps come equipped with smart technology that monitors performance in real-time, allowing for predictive maintenance. This means you can catch potential issues before they become costly problems—an innovation that saves time and money.

Additionally, many of these modern pumps utilize materials designed to minimize wear and tear, which enhances their lifespan and efficiency. Imagine how much smoother your operations would run if pump-related issues became a thing of the past!
